  • Do I need a passport to fly from Tucson to Newark Airport?

    No, a passport is not required for this domestic route, but you will need a real ID-compliant driver's license, a state ID, or another TSA-accepted form of identification.

  • What is the time difference between Tucson and Newark Airport?

    Newark Airport is 3 hours ahead of Tucson (Eastern Time vs Mountain Time). Plan for the time shift when scheduling connections or first-day activities.

  • Opting for an airline that offers greater flexibility in terms of carry-on baggage regulations can be beneficial when traveling from Tucson to Newark Liberty Airport, particularly if you have a substantial amount of luggage. Southwest Airlines permits passengers to bring one carry-on bag along with one personal item without incurring any extra charges. They also allow each passenger to check two bags weighing up to 50 lbs each for no charge. This generous and accommodating baggage policy ensures that travelers enjoy increased flexibility and convenience.
